Bioidentical hormones are plant-derived and structurally identical to the hormones your body naturally produces. BHRT is used to restore hormone levels to a range where you feel your best. Treatment is personalized based on your symptoms and lab results.
When prescribed by a trained provider and monitored with lab work, bioidentical HRT is considered safe and effective for most patients. The 2002 Women’s Health Initiative study was widely misreported. Modern evidence supports HRT, particularly when started within 10 years of menopause onset. Your provider will discuss risks and benefits specific to your health history.
Bioidentical hormones have the same molecular structure as your body’s own hormones. Synthetic hormones have a different structure, which is why some patients experience more side effects. Bioidentical hormones can also be customized and compounded to match your specific needs.

Most patients begin to notice improvement within 2 to 4 weeks of starting treatment. Full benefits are typically realized within 1 to 4 months. Your provider will monitor your progress and adjust your treatment as needed to ensure you’re getting the best results.
Yes. We prescribe GLP-1 receptor agonists including tirzepatide and semaglutide for qualifying patients. Your provider will evaluate whether these medications are appropriate during your weight loss consultation.
Peptides are short chains of amino acids that act as signaling molecules in the body. Therapeutic peptides can support recovery, sleep quality, immune health, and cellular repair. They are used in functional and regenerative medicine to optimize health beyond what traditional hormone replacement addresses.
We treat symptoms of hormonal decline in both men and women, including fatigue, brain fog, weight gain, low libido, mood changes, poor recovery, sleep disruption, joint pain, and muscle loss. We also provide peptide therapy for immune support, longevity, and cellular repair.
